Competition is healthy, but most often, it is handled in cut-throat style - which is VERY UNHEALTHY!  No one wins in a cut-throat competitive environment, not even the consumer!  On the surface, it manifests in dirt cheap prices, and the consumer seems to win as a result - however, that win comes at a very high price they feel on the back end - piss poor customer service, inferior products, and undelivered promises.

Competion can and should raise the bar, not tank it in the toilet!  Healthy competition will cause entrepreneurs to upgrade the value they offer at the price offered, and frankly - that healthy competition tends to show up when collaboration is encouraged.

"Collaboration is a very healthy think tank experience. A mastermind of peers wanting to upgrade and uplift others around them."  Trudy Beerman

Collaboration leads to pooling of resources, a celebration of best practices, and a sharpening of brilliant minds to even higher levels.

Collaboration is why doctors meet at conferences to share medical breakthroughs with others in the field.  Collaboration is why news in one part of the world is shared in others.  Collaboration is how animals survive in family groups.

Just because there are 1 million songs on love on the radio does not mean I should not write my song.   

I guarantee, if I gave 10 leaders in the same genre the same speaking title, and a list of the same 5 points I wanted them to cover, all 10 speeches would be very different.  However, knowing that 9 other speakers are going to speak on the same topic means all 10 speakers will work harder to deliver their best performance.  THIS IS THE WIN WIN WIN! A win for the listener, a win for the speakers, and a win for the inviting organization. 

Change how you view your peers, and grow!  Collaborate people!
